Acute vitamin A toxicity: a report of three paediatric cases.

Rebecca M Hayman1, Stuart R Dalziel.   

Abstract

The following report describes three paediatric cases of vitamin A toxicity secondary to carnivorous fish liver ingestion. Further discussion of vitamin A toxicity and management of toxicity is included.
